Electrical Conductivity

One of the primary uses of copper knitted wire mesh is in electrical applications. Its excellent electrical conductivity makes it ideal for grounding and shielding purposes. For instance, in the telecommunications industry, copper knitted wire mesh is often employed in the construction of cables due to its ability to reduce electromagnetic interference (EMI). To implement this in your projects, consider using copper knitted wire mesh as a protective layer around sensitive electronics to enhance performance.

Practical Tip:

Ensure that the wire mesh is properly grounded. This will maximize its effectiveness in shielding against EMI and provide safety against electrical surges.

Heat Transfer

Another key use of copper knitted wire mesh is in heat transfer applications. Copper's inherent thermal conductivity is beneficial in scenarios where efficient heat dissipation is essential. Industries such as aerospace and automotive frequently utilize copper knitted wire mesh in heat exchangers. In these setups, the mesh facilitates better airflow and heat transfer, resulting in improved engine performance and efficiency.

Practical Tip:

When integrating copper knitted wire mesh into heat exchangers, always consider the mesh’s thickness and density. These factors will significantly influence its effectiveness in heat transfer.

Filtration Applications

Copper knitted wire mesh plays a crucial role in various filtration processes due to its unique weaving structure. This material can effectively filter out particles from liquids and gases, making it invaluable in chemical processing and environmental engineering. For example, it can be used in oil filtration systems to remove impurities without damaging the fluid being processed. Users looking to implement copper knitted wire mesh in their filtration systems should opt for a mesh size that fits their specific needs.

Practical Tip:

To maintain optimal filtration efficiency, regularly inspect and replace worn-out copper knitted wire mesh, ensuring that the mesh does not become clogged with contaminants.

Architectural and Artistic Uses

Beyond industrial applications, copper knitted wire mesh has also found a place in architecture and art. Its unique aesthetic appeal is increasingly being used by artists and designers to create stunning installations and sculptures. For instance, the mesh can be used as a decorative façade or accent piece in buildings, providing both beauty and functional benefits such as light filtering and air flow. If you're a designer or architect, experimenting with copper knitted wire mesh can lead to innovative design elements that stand out.

Practical Tip:

When utilizing copper knitted wire mesh in architectural designs, consider its patina over time. Copper naturally develops a greenish hue as it oxidizes, offering a visually captivating look but also requiring maintenance if you prefer the original shine.

Common Questions and Answers About Copper Knitted Wire Mesh

What are the main advantages of using copper knitted wire mesh?

The primary advantages include electrical conductivity, thermal conductivity, corrosion resistance, and versatility in applications across various industries.

How is copper knitted wire mesh manufactured?

Copper knitted wire mesh is produced by interlocking copper strands in a specific pattern, which provides both flexibility and strength, making it suitable for diverse applications.

Is copper knitted wire mesh environmentally friendly?

Yes, copper is a recyclable material, making copper knitted wire mesh an environmentally friendly option for industries focused on sustainability.
